If you simply wanted to clear out posts, the safest way is to use the prune function in the control panel. You might need to run the "rebuild" functions in the maintenance menu afterwards.

Deleting the files manually is tricky, because you have to know exactly what all the files are, whether there are interdependencies among the files, which ones the UBB automatically creates, etc.
